\h UddlmZmZddlmZmZddlmZddiZee e fe d<dedd fd Z efd ed e dee d d ffd Zy ))Dict Generator)CONTENT_CHUNK_SIZEResponse)NetworkConnectionErrorzAccept-EncodingidentityHEADERSrespreturnNcd}t|jtr |jjd}n |j}d|j cxkrdkr"nn|j d|d|j }n6d|j cxkrdkr!nn|j d |d|j }|r t|| y#t$r|jjd}YwxYw) Nzutf-8z iso-8859-1iiz Client Error: z for url: iXz Server Error: )response) isinstancereasonbytesdecodeUnicodeDecodeError status_codeurlr)r http_error_msgrs ^/root/niggaflix-v3/playground/venv/lib/python3.12/site-packages/pip/_internal/network/utils.pyraise_for_statusrsN$++u%  6[[''0F d$$ xz$(( L    &3 & xz$(( L $^dCC" 6[['' 5F 6sC$C*)C*r chunk_sizec#K |jj|dD]}|y#t$r& |jj|}|sYy|$wxYww)z3Given a requests Response, provide the data chunks.F)decode_contentN)rawstreamAttributeErrorread)rrchunks rresponse_chunksr!9st#\\(( .!1)  E4K5 6 LL%%j1EK s%A&+A'AAAA)typingrrpip._vendor.requests.modelsrrpip._internal.exceptionsrr str__annotations__rintrr!rr*sn""D;*-j9c3h9D8DD:+=''$''udD !'r)